Besoin d'aide pour une formule qui comprend 3 colonnes

Résolu/Fermé
Tina31470 Messages postés 24 Date d'inscription jeudi 28 janvier 2016 Statut Membre Dernière intervention 9 novembre 2016 - 9 nov. 2016 à 10:57
Tina31470 Messages postés 24 Date d'inscription jeudi 28 janvier 2016 Statut Membre Dernière intervention 9 novembre 2016 - 9 nov. 2016 à 18:56
Bonjour,
J'aurai besoin de votre aide.
J'ai un tableau qui contient plusieurs colonnes mais j'ai besoin d'une formule sur une seule mais qui prend en compte 3 colonnes.
ex: en A deux critères : "trad" ou "forf"
en B date d'inscription
en C date limite

Mon problème est que ma colonne C doit apparaître en rouge si "Moisdécaler.3mois si "forf" ou 6 mois si "Trad" et jaune 1 mois avant chaque limite.

J'espère être assez claire lol

Merci de votre aide

Tina


A voir également:

1 réponse

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 396
9 nov. 2016 à 11:36
Bonjour
complètez vos explications
il s'agit de décaler à partir de quelle date, du jour en cours? et sur quelle base, date d'inscription? ou date limite?
à vous lire
crdlmnt
0
Tina31470 Messages postés 24 Date d'inscription jeudi 28 janvier 2016 Statut Membre Dernière intervention 9 novembre 2016
9 nov. 2016 à 12:01
FORMULE DATE INSCRIPTION DATE LIMITE

TRAD date limite à 6 mois si "trad" en rouge
forf date limite à 5 mois si "trad" en jaune
date limite à 3 mois si " forf" en rouge
date limite à 2 mois si "forf" en jaune


j'espère que cela est plus claire..

ex: date inscrip + 6 mois si en trad
date inscrip + 3 mois si en forf

Merci
0
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 396
9 nov. 2016 à 12:38
toujours pas compris
vous voulez une mise en forme en couleur d'après un calcul ou un calcul d'après une mise en couleur?
(dans ce second cas, c'est au mieux du VBA (je en connais pas à ce pobnt là) au pire ça n'est pas possible
ou alors voulez vous un calcul de C par rapport au code en A?
0
Tina31470 Messages postés 24 Date d'inscription jeudi 28 janvier 2016 Statut Membre Dernière intervention 9 novembre 2016 >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022
9 nov. 2016 à 13:47
alors j'ai besoin qu'apparaisse dans " date limite" plusieurs critères.

En 1er

si en A j'ai " trad" ma date limite doit être B (date inscrip) + 6 mois
avec C devient rouge si date limite atteinte
avec C devient jaune 1 mois avant le date limite

En 2°
Si en A j'ai "Forf" ma date limite doit être B(date inscript) + 3 mois
avec C devient rouge si date limite atteinte
avec C devient jaune 1 mois avant le date limite

Merci
0
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 6 396 > Tina31470 Messages postés 24 Date d'inscription jeudi 28 janvier 2016 Statut Membre Dernière intervention 9 novembre 2016
Modifié par Vaucluse le 9/11/2016 à 14:14
Comme ça, ça va mieux

1° pour afficher la date en C la formule

=SI(B1="";"";MOIS.DECALER(B1;SI(A1="trad";6;3))

_ nécessite que A1 soit obligatoirement remplie avec Trad ou Forf

s'il y a un risque de non conformité des entrées en A et B, on peut écrire (à patrtir d'Excel 2007 seulement)

=SIERREUR(MOIS/DECALER(B1;SI(A1="Trad";6;3));"erreur de données")

Pour le formatagede C quelque soit A (puisque seule C est concernée
  • Sélectionner le champ C
  • Mise en forme conditionnelle / Nouvelle régle / Utiliser une formule
  • formule pour le rouge:

=ET($C1>0;AUJOURDHUI()>=$C1))
  • formatez
  • la formule pour le jaune:

=ET($C1>0;AUJOURDHUI()>=MOIS.DECALER($C1;-3))

crdmnt
0
Tina31470 Messages postés 24 Date d'inscription jeudi 28 janvier 2016 Statut Membre Dernière intervention 9 novembre 2016 >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022
9 nov. 2016 à 14:35
Merci vaucluse pour ta réponse.

Tout fonctionne sauf pour la mise en forme conditionnelle quand la date de 3 ou 6 mois est dépassée ..

tout s'affiche en jaune

Aurais tu une idée si cela n'est pas abuser ?
0